They are the two sides of the same coin: an extensive coastline and an interior that gains in green hues as we climb up to mountains such as Puig Campana or the Aitana or Mariola mountains. Alicante has a stimulating capital on the edge of the Mediterranean, the birthplace of artists such as the rapper Arkano, who accompanies us on a very personal tour of this city that has seen the birth and growth of one of the best freestylers in the world. We complete the visit with the voices of Marina Campello, a tourism technician from Alicante City Council, and the journalist and writer from Alicante, Javier Ramos, author of the blog LugaresconHistoria.com. After visiting the tiny and charming island of Tabarca with María del Mar Valera, president of the Alicante Hotel and Catering Business Association, we continued our journey through towns such as Orihuela, Elche, Alcoy, Torrevieja, Benidorm, Villajoyosa and Calpe. In addition, the director of the programme Por tres razones on Radio Nacional, Mamen Asencio, reveals Altea to us, its very white seafaring town. The expert in hiking, Fernando Prieto, in charge of the web LinkAlicante.com, contributes with good ideas to enjoy the most natural side of the environment, where we can also find very curious museums. The one dedicated to the Alicante bonfires is presented by Toñi Martín-Zarco, president of the Sant Joan Bonfire Federation; the one on Elda's shoes by its director, Loles Esteve. Finally, we visited the Valencian Toy Museum, whose coordinator, Pilar Avilés, opened the doors of its headquarters in the town of Ibi.
